Donald Richard Greenburg

January 18, 1946 - March 20, 2024

Donald Richard Greenburg, 78, of Salem, Virginia, went to be with the Lord on Wednesday, March 20, 2024. Born on January 18, 1946, in Orange County, California to the late Robert C. and Alice Peace Greenburg, he retired to and raised his family in Franklin County, Va.

Always athletic and fiercely competitive, he lettered in three sports in high school: football, basketball, and baseball. He loved sports and horse racing and remained a loyal Dodgers fan, even in Va. Mr. Greenburg retired after 20 years of service in the United States Navy having achieved the rank of Sr. Chief and as a civilian, worked for more than 20 years in maintenance for Marriott/Wyndham.
